Надайте приклади різних значень текстових величин. Які можна зробити операції з цими величинами? Які функції
Надайте приклади різних значень текстових величин. Які можна зробити операції з цими величинами? Які функції використовуються для обробки текстових значень у мовах програмування?
Звездная_Тайна 47
Приклади різних текстових величин можуть включати назви студентів, назви книг, назви міст, адреси, електронні пошти та багато іншого.У програмуванні існує багато операцій, які можна виконувати з текстовими значеннями. Основні операції включають наступне:
1. Конкатенація: Ця операція дозволяє з"єднувати дві текстові величини разом. Наприклад, якщо ми маємо текст "Привіт" і текст "Світе", ми можемо їх об"єднати, використовуючи оператор "+" у багатьох мовах програмування, щоб отримати новий рядок "Привіт, Світе".
2. Довжина рядка: Ця функція дозволяє визначити кількість символів у текстовому значенні. Наприклад, якщо ми маємо текст "Привіт, Світе", можемо скористатись функцією довжини, щоб отримати значення 13.
3. Вирізання: Ця операція дозволяє вибрати певну частину текстового значення. Наприклад, якщо ми маємо текст "Привіт, Світе", можемо використати функцію вирізати, щоб вибрати лише слово "Світе".
4. Переведення у верхній або нижній регістр: Ці функції дозволяють змінити регістр символів у текстовому значенні. Наприклад, функція нижнього регістру може перетворити текст "Привіт" на "привіт".
5. Порівняння: Ця операція дозволяє порівняти два текстових значення, щоб визначити, чи вони рівні або чи одне більше або менше іншого.
У багатьох мовах програмування є такі функції, як `split`, `replace`, `substring`, `indexOf` та інші, які дозволяють виконувати різні додаткові операції з текстовими значеннями. Наприклад, функція `split` дозволяє розділити текст на частини, використовуючи певний розділювач, а функція `replace` дозволяє замінити певні символи або підрядки утексті на інші символи або підрядки.
Отже, текстові значення можуть бути оброблені за допомогою різних операцій в мовах програмування, залежно від потреби та доступних функцій у конкретній мові.